Transaction 65a5159e8b66b357d6a56fc96e1e1fef18aef5610de5fbe51857777f3b7acccb

1 Input
1 Outputs
  • 65a5159e8b66b357d6a56fc96e1e1fef18aef5610de5fbe51857777f3b7acccb:0
  • value  366169
    address  3MEKwq2uGyyvo4R73TBn9qeFkfiVD6v5qM